About the role - Continuous Improvement Lead

We are seeking a high-potential Continuous Improvement Lead to join our factory team.

The successful candidate will own results for clean inspect and lube, centerline management system, 5S system, integrity of process data and the Oscar scrap elimination system. This employee will actively participate in annual planning, PDCA meetings, Daily Level 2 (Oscar) meetings.

The CI lead will develop standards, define centerlines and lead transformation analysis. Develop control strategies to enable operators to respond to out of control situations. Leads root cause problem solving efforts on key chronic losses for the process. Coaches teams on CIL, CLM, 5S, and Oscar systems execution. Coaches and develops teams by building problem solving skills within the process.

What are you going to do?
  • Facilitates the line loss analysis (waste elimination and yield improvement) and line throughput improvement plans - Leads transformation analysis and centerline definition and associated standard development
  • Analysis daily and shift line data to identify and prioritize loss elimination opportunities
  • Participates in internal audit program, food safety committee, and sanitary design team
  • Spends time on the floor to gather information on stops, centerlines and changeovers over the past 24 hours
  • Investigates initial root cause of top stops
  • Begin to develop plan for the day for ownership areas
  • Discuss top stops and root cause. Establish countermeasures in plan for the day
  • Ensure centerline completion and compliance. Create countermeasures on any outages
  • Works with Process Owner, and Maintenance Lead to address sporadic losses
  • Lead Universal Problem Solving to eliminate chronic losses for the line
  • Manage centerline and Quality Daily Management Systems
  • Assist in the implementation of the Quality KHMS program and acts as trainer of new associates
  • Flexibility to occasionally adjust to shifts to work with employees from all shifts as required
